Find the value(s) of k, such that the mass-spring system described by each of the equations below is undergoing resonance. 2u\" + ku = 9 sin 5t 7u\" + ku = pi cos t

Solution

a)

Equatoin can be written as

u\'\'+k/2 u=9/2 sin(5t)

Natural frequency is sqrt{k/2} assuming k is positive

So for resonanc we need

sqrt{k/2}=5

k=50

b)

Equation can be written as

u\'\'+k/7 u=pi /7 cos(t)

Natural frequency =sqrt{k/7} which should be equal to forcing frequency

Hence,

sqrt{k/7}=1

k=7
